What is BTU in AC?
BTU (British Thermal Unit) measures cooling capacity. Higher BTU means more cooling power. A 1-ton AC = 12,000 BTU/hr. Our calculator recommends the right size for your room.
How many BTU per square foot?
General rule: 20 BTU per square foot for average conditions. Adjust for ceiling height, sun exposure, number of windows, and local climate for accurate sizing.
What happens with wrong BTU AC?
Undersized AC runs continuously without reaching temperature. Oversized AC short-cycles, wastes electricity, and fails to remove humidity properly. Correct sizing is crucial.
